Since most composite products aren’t as inflexible as their wooden counterparts, they don’t cover imperfections within the framing quite as well. That’s why stretching a string across the joist spacing for composite deck boardscan assist detect spots that could be higher than others. These spots can be addressed with an influence hand planer to provide you a nicer, smoother floor for the deck of your desires.

To set up a composite deck over concrete, you’re going to want a sleeper system. A sleeper system is a substructure made up of joists that sits on the surface of the concrete under the decking. Deck boards (including perimeter boards used for picture-framing) ought to be put in in order that they lengthen past the outer rim joists by less than 2” lengthwise and 1” width wise. Rather than putting in screws through the top of each deck board, clips are first attached to the framing boards and the decking is then hooked up to the clips. The subsequent edge which goes to sit down alongside another composite decking board, set up a set of composite t clips into the groove and as soon as again screw down into the joist below. Its advisable to make use of one t clip onto every of the supporting joists. Cladco composite decking can be simply secured to joists that are on a substructure support base using Cladco t clips with stainless steel screw. These clips permit adequate expansion and contraction of the composite decking boards.
